Output 0883bb347ae219a38833cc3189f5355dcb77a50cd0459f435c0a45a285d50691:0

value
10366851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ee0c01427dc113754c5caedb9a82de106d693bb5 OP_EQUAL
address
3PPh8KGzbkRUzqCd1cxt2jWFRvRPnJ7oaG
transaction
0883bb347ae219a38833cc3189f5355dcb77a50cd0459f435c0a45a285d50691
confirmations
389476
spent
true